One of those not great, but not horrible experiences. The calzones crust was good and cooked to the right temp, but the filling was under seasoned and bland. The sauce included was just plain tomato sauce.
Parking: Next to ample public parking
Wheelchair accessibility: The front is wheelchair accessible, but the outdoor dining area is not.

My wife has been going here for over 30 years. I swung in yesterday afternoon to get the same order we get about once a month, a dozen mild extra crispy wings and a med pepperoni pizza.They put a garlic butter sauce on the wings so my wife called and took them back to exchange them for mild buffalo. The manager took the wings from her, washed them off, put the right sauce on, and handed them back saying they were new wings. They were soggy and tasted awful, we're done with this establishment.Everyone makes mistakes, it was the failure to fix it and lying about it that was completely unacceptable.
